While it may not come equipped with a ticket office, Kilmaurs ensures passengers can efficiently manage their journeys with accessible ticket machines available on-site. These machines allow passengers to purchase tickets and collect those bought online. For those with accessibility needs, you’ll be pleased to know that Kilmaurs provides an accessible ticket machine and features such as induction loops. Although staff help isn't available, customer help points and screens displaying departure information make navigation straightforward. Despite the lack of toilets or refreshment options, Kilmaurs station does deliver on providing essential services like CCTV for safety and free car parking for travelers. The car park boasts 20 spaces, with two spaces specially reserved for Blue Badge holders.

Cricklewood Station boasts a variety of facilities to ensure a comfortable journey. The ticket office is open Monday to Friday from 6:10 AM to 7:10 PM, Saturday from 8:40 AM to 4:45 PM, and on Sunday from 9:15 AM to 5:45 PM. Ticket machines are available 24/7, allowing for online ticket collection and assistance for those with a Disabled Persons Railcard.
Though the station lacks a waiting room or lounge, it does offer seating areas for its passengers. CCTV cameras are strategically placed to ensure safety, while customer help points are always accessible. A key highlight is the station's commitment to accessibility, offering step-free access to platform 1 and well-designed ticket machines for ease of use. Staff assistance is available throughout operating hours, ensuring a seamless travel experience.
